数据库查找用什么命令好
-
数据库查找可以使用不同的命令,具体使用哪个命令取决于你使用的数据库管理系统(DBMS)和你要实现的查询目标。以下是几种常用的数据库查找命令:
-
SELECT命令:SELECT是最常用的数据库查询命令,用于从数据库表中检索数据。你可以使用SELECT命令指定要检索的列、表、条件和排序等。
-
WHERE子句:WHERE子句通常与SELECT命令一起使用,用于筛选满足特定条件的行。你可以使用WHERE子句指定一个或多个条件,以限制查询结果。
-
JOIN命令:JOIN命令用于将两个或多个表中的数据联接在一起。你可以使用JOIN命令根据两个表之间的关联键将它们的数据进行匹配和组合。
-
GROUP BY命令:GROUP BY命令用于将查询结果按照指定的列进行分组。你可以使用GROUP BY命令将数据分组并对每个组进行聚合计算,如求和、平均值等。
-
ORDER BY命令:ORDER BY命令用于按照指定的列对查询结果进行排序。你可以使用ORDER BY命令将查询结果按照升序或降序排列。
除了上述常用的命令外,不同的数据库管理系统还可能提供其他特定的查询命令和功能,例如子查询、存储过程、视图等。因此,你需要根据具体的数据库管理系统和查询需求选择适合的命令来进行数据库查找。
1年前 -
-
数据库查找可以使用SQL语句来实现。SQL(Structured Query Language)是一种用于管理和操作关系型数据库的语言,它提供了一系列的命令和语法规则,用于对数据库进行查询、插入、更新、删除等操作。
下面是一些常用的SQL命令来进行数据库查找:
-
SELECT:用于从数据库中查询数据。可以使用SELECT语句来指定要查询的表、列以及查询条件。例如,SELECT * FROM table_name WHERE condition; 这条语句将从名为table_name的表中查询符合条件condition的所有列。
-
WHERE:用于指定查询条件。WHERE子句可以配合SELECT、UPDATE和DELETE语句来过滤出符合条件的数据。例如,SELECT * FROM table_name WHERE condition; 这条语句将查询符合条件condition的所有列。
-
LIKE:用于模糊匹配查询。可以使用LIKE语句来匹配指定模式的数据。例如,SELECT * FROM table_name WHERE column_name LIKE 'pattern'; 这条语句将查询列column_name中匹配模式pattern的所有行。
-
ORDER BY:用于对查询结果进行排序。可以使用ORDER BY语句来指定按照某一列或多列进行升序或降序排序。例如,SELECT * FROM table_name ORDER BY column_name ASC/DESC; 这条语句将按照列column_name进行升序或降序排序。
-
GROUP BY:用于对查询结果进行分组。可以使用GROUP BY语句将查询结果按照某一列或多列进行分组。例如,SELECT column_name1, SUM(column_name2) FROM table_name GROUP BY column_name1; 这条语句将按照列column_name1进行分组,并对每个分组求出列column_name2的总和。
-
JOIN:用于将多个表连接在一起进行查询。可以使用JOIN语句将多个表按照指定的连接条件进行连接,并获取相关联的数据。例如,SELECT * FROM table1 JOIN table2 ON table1.column_name = table2.column_name; 这条语句将按照列column_name将表table1和table2连接在一起。
除了以上常用的SQL命令,还有其他更高级的命令和语法规则,如子查询、聚合函数、嵌套查询等,可以根据具体的需求来选择合适的命令来进行数据库查找。
1年前 -
-
数据库查找通常使用SQL语言进行操作。SQL(Structured Query Language)是一种用于管理关系型数据库的标准化语言。在SQL中,有一些常用的命令可以用来进行数据库查找操作,包括SELECT、WHERE、ORDER BY、GROUP BY等。
以下是数据库查找的一般操作流程:
-
连接数据库:首先需要使用适当的数据库管理系统(如MySQL、Oracle、SQL Server等)连接到数据库。连接数据库的方法和命令因数据库管理系统而异。
-
选择表:在连接数据库后,需要选择要进行查找操作的表。使用USE命令选择数据库,然后使用FROM命令选择表。例如:
USE database_name; SELECT * FROM table_name; -
选择列:在进行数据库查找操作时,可以选择要查询的列。使用SELECT命令并列出要查询的列名。例如:
SELECT column1, column2, ... FROM table_name; -
添加条件:使用WHERE命令添加条件,以过滤查询结果。WHERE语句可以使用各种比较运算符(如等于、大于、小于等)和逻辑运算符(如AND、OR、NOT)来设置条件。例如:
SELECT column1, column2, ... FROM table_name WHERE condition; -
排序结果:使用ORDER BY命令对查询结果进行排序。可以按照一个或多个列进行升序或降序排序。例如:
SELECT column1, column2, ... FROM table_name ORDER BY column1 ASC, column2 DESC; -
分组结果:使用GROUP BY命令对查询结果进行分组。可以按照一个或多个列进行分组。例如:
SELECT column1, column2, ... FROM table_name GROUP BY column1, column2; -
执行查询:使用以上命令设置完查询条件后,使用SELECT语句执行查询。查询结果将返回满足条件的行。例如:
SELECT column1, column2, ... FROM table_name WHERE condition ORDER BY column1 ASC; -
关闭数据库连接:当查询完成后,使用适当的命令关闭数据库连接。例如:
QUIT;
以上是数据库查找的一般操作流程和常用命令。根据具体的查询需求,可以灵活运用这些命令来进行数据库查找操作。
1年前 -